The Pros And Cons Of Using A Business Broker To Sell Your Business

If you are considering selling your business, you may be wondering whether or not you need to hire a business broker to help facilitate the sale While it is possible to sell your business on your own, there are many benefits to hiring a professional broker to assist you in the process In this article, we will explore the pros and cons of using a business broker to sell your business.

One of the main advantages of using a business broker is their expertise in the field Business brokers are trained professionals who have experience selling businesses and understanding the intricacies of the process They have access to a network of potential buyers and can help you navigate the various steps involved in selling a business, such as valuing your business, marketing it to potential buyers, and negotiating the terms of the sale By hiring a business broker, you can leverage their knowledge and expertise to ensure a smooth and successful sale.

Another benefit of using a business broker is their ability to maintain confidentiality throughout the selling process If you try to sell your business on your own, you may inadvertently disclose sensitive information to competitors or employees, which could negatively impact your business Business brokers understand the importance of confidentiality and have procedures in place to protect your sensitive information and ensure that only qualified buyers have access to it.

Business brokers also have the advantage of being able to market your business more effectively than you could on your own They have access to a wide range of marketing channels, such as online listings, trade publications, and industry contacts, which can help attract more potential buyers to your business By leveraging their marketing expertise, business brokers can help you reach a larger pool of qualified buyers and increase the likelihood of selling your business quickly and for a favorable price.

One of the main disadvantages is the cost associated with hiring a broker Business brokers typically charge a commission based on the sale price of the business, which can eat into your profits Before deciding to hire a business broker, it is important to weigh the potential costs against the benefits they offer and determine whether the investment is worth it for you.

Another potential drawback of using a business broker is the loss of control over the selling process When you hire a broker to sell your business, you are essentially entrusting them to handle all aspects of the sale on your behalf While this can be beneficial in terms of the broker’s expertise and ability to streamline the process, it can also result in you feeling disconnected from the sale and not having as much input as you would like If maintaining control over the sale process is important to you, you may want to consider selling your business on your own instead of using a broker.

In conclusion, whether or not you need a business broker to sell your business depends on your individual circumstances and preferences While there are many benefits to hiring a broker, such as their expertise, marketing resources, and confidentiality measures, there are also costs and potential drawbacks to consider Before making a decision, carefully weigh the pros and cons of using a business broker and determine whether their services align with your goals and priorities Ultimately, the choice to use a broker or not is a personal one that should be based on what is best for you and your business.
